SUMMARY

Bonnard is acknowledged as a master of modern art, following in the traditionf the Impressionists. He is best known as a painter of intimate, domesticnteriors but he was also a highly accomplished draughtsman who produced aealth of lithographs and drawings. This volume illustrates the full range ofis output, from his early works inspired by Japanese prints, to the richlyoloured works of his later years.;This series acts as an introduction to keyrtists and movements in art history. Each title contains 48 full-page colourlates, accompanied by extensive notes, and numerous comparativellustrations in colour or black and white, a concise introduction, selectibliography and detailed source information for the images. Monographs onndividual artists also feature a brief chronology.Bell, Julian is the author of 'Bonnard' with ISBN 9780714830520 and ISBN 0714830526.
